K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ia (AP) — Malaysia’s Mahathir Mohamad held an audience with the nation’s king on Thursday, fueling talks he may have the majority support to return as prime minister after his abrupt resignation and the collapse of his ruling coalition this week. Mahathir was summoned to the palace in the morning and left an hour later. He didn’t speak to reporters.
